Most panels experience a drop in efficiency of 0. 5% for every degree Celsius above 25°C (77°F). Keeping panels cool boosts energy output, which is why ventilation behind panels and quality insulation within the building work hand in hand.

Instead of converting sunlight directly into electricity, as photovoltaics does, solar thermal harnesses the sun's energy to heat a fluid called a heat carrier and then uses that heat to generate electricity or provide heat for industrial or domestic applications.
